Congress turned to the platform X to announce that a press briefing was being streamed live for the public to follow. The party said the event was organised by the Indian Youth Congress and was carried in real time so that viewers could tune in directly as it happened.

## Who Addressed the Briefing
According to the party's post, the press briefing was led by Anil Bhardwaj and Uday Bhanu. Both leaders spoke before the media and laid out the party's position on the issues they raised.

## Where It Was Held
The briefing took place at the AICC office in New Delhi. The live feed was relayed from this venue, allowing people across the country to watch the proceedings as they unfolded.
